02 What the workshop includes, and what it doesn't

Design Sprint with Claude is an online workshop in two sessions, a week apart, for people who run a small service business and want to design an app for it. The sessions take place on Zoom, in a group, on the dates and hours published on the dates page of the site. Next cohort: Wednesdays 14 and 21 October 2026, 09:30 to 14:30 each session. The workshop is conducted in Hebrew.

Day one is the research, in Claude Code with your team of agents: the plan, the research criteria, the opportunities, the guide for your conversations, the user and product map, and the solutions. Each is made by Claude Code, and you review and approve it. Between the sessions you hold three real conversations, with your team or your clients. Day two is the design. Claude Code designs the app from what you heard: what it does, the screens, the flows and the order to build in. You leave with the design of your app, ready to build, the research and map, ready for the next round, your team of agents, set up in your own Claude Code, and a method for the next tool.

The workshop is about research and design. It does not include building the app, and it does not cover domains, email, hosting or putting the app online. Building it is the next step: at home, with Claude Code, or with anyone you choose.

Before the first session we email you the short prep videos; with them you install Claude Code, set up your folders and create your team of agents. The setup takes about an hour or two, at home. You come to the first session with a paid Claude plan (Pro is enough), Claude Code installed on your computer, and your folders and team of agents ready. The Claude subscription is bought by you directly from Anthropic and is not included in the workshop price.

04 Cancellation by participants

Our cancellation policy is simple:

  • Cancellation up to 7 days before the first session: full refund.
  • Cancellation within the 7 days before the first session: no refund, but you'll receive a full credit toward a future cohort of the workshop.
  • Once the first session begins, the workshop is under way: the registration can no longer be cancelled, and no refund or credit is given, including for the second session.

In addition, you retain the cancellation rights under Israel's Consumer Protection Law and its regulations for a distance-selling transaction: you may cancel the transaction within 14 days of making it, provided the cancellation is made at least two days, not counting rest days, before the first session. In such a case the payment will be refunded, less a cancellation fee of 5% of the transaction amount or ₪100, whichever is lower. To cancel, contact us by email.
